Transaction 6684508cc9c435a0e2b4807ffc5670bcf01430fa03a8b09d98307f93acc19eed

5 Input
2 Outputs
  • 6684508cc9c435a0e2b4807ffc5670bcf01430fa03a8b09d98307f93acc19eed:0
  • value  5041290
    address  3F9KrUBMtdeq4d33PNqzVT2YL9QhTcKxum
  • 6684508cc9c435a0e2b4807ffc5670bcf01430fa03a8b09d98307f93acc19eed:1
  • value  40388
    address  3BMEXtEy75RsQ6QNMynGGdXPfzpK84vzRN